VFW Post 7031 in Boone To Host Live Music Benefit This Friday
Money To Be Used for Improvements To VFW Building
Story by David Brewer
Since 1946, Veterans of Foreign Wars Post 7031 has given High Country vets a place to come together during times of war and peace to carry out its mission: to honor the dead by helping the living. With more than 205 members, 85 Mens Auxiliary members and 60 Ladies Auxiliary members, the post, located in Boone, continues to serve the community through charitable events and annual fundraisers.
This Friday, March 7, VFW Post 7031 will open its doors to the public to raise money for renovations needed at its building located at 144 VFW Drive The benefit will begin at 8:00 p.m. and will feature live music by High Country blues masters The King Bees. Admission is $10 per person and $15 for couples.
According to Post Commander Alan Scott, the VFW’s facility was built in the mid-1960s and is beginning to show its age. Among the host of improvements members hope to make in the coming months Scott noted the immediate need of a new paint job and new windows.
“We do a lot of good for everybody, but our post is falling down around us,” said Scott. “We just need people to come out and support our veterans.”
In 2007, Post 7031 donated $10,000 to charitable causes in the High Country through fundraisers, including its annual poker run in August and dinners hosted by the Ladies Auxiliary the third Tuesday of each month.
Scott said that Post 7031 has signed up nearly 50 new members since the beginning of the year and is hoping that the numbers continue to grow. The post is ranked fourth in the state and fifth in the nation for membership in its population category.
“We’re out to support our veterans and troops and we just put the politics aside,” said Scott. “We do anything we can to help.”
